Hey guys, I'm going to build a system with the following setup (overclocked):

Abit NF7-S v2.0 MB
AMD 2500+ Mobile
PC3200 Crucial memory
other stuff...

I haven't been keeping up with video cards for over a year now, but I understand the FX5200s support DX 9, while at the same time are slower than Ti4200's, which don't support DX 9.

I'm thinking of getting a card that supports DX9, but has performance, maybe like a Radeon 9500/9600. Two main questions. Anyone know of any good brands out there with decent price (I'm not spending an arm and a leg)? I'm looking to spend roughly about $100. And anyone know of issues with ATI with Abit NF7-S v2.0?

9700's go for $110 in the classifieds, or you could get a 9600pro for about that new. The 9700 is a minimum of 25% faster in everything, and with pretties on, near twice as fast.
